Bohlender Stirrer Shafts, PTFE with Stainless Steel Core, Half-Moon, 450 mm Length, 8 mm Shaft Diameter, feature a PTFE-jacketed stainless steel shaft and a solid PTFE paddle for safe and chemically resistant mixing. The stainless steel core provides stability and allows secure attachment to a stirrer chuck. The semi-circular paddle shape is ideal for mixing in round-bottom flasks, and the pivoting blade allows insertion into vessels with narrow necks or ground joints. These stirrer shafts are similar in size to KPG glass stirring rods and are easily interchangeable.
Product Features
- Crescent-shaped stirring rotors, PTFE
- PTFE-jacketed stainless steel shaft with solid PTFE paddle
- Stainless steel core ensures stability and safe attachment to stirrer chuck
- Thick PTFE coating ensures the medium only contacts PTFE
- High chemical resistance, suitable for almost all applications
- Extremely nonstick: residues repelled from shaft and paddle
- Similar in size to KPG glass stirring rods, easily interchangeable
- Operating temperature: -200°C to +250°C
- Semi-circular paddle shape ideal for round-bottom flasks
- Pivoting blade allows insertion into vessels with narrow necks and/or ground joints
- Additional sizes and accessories available on request
- Information on mixing effects of different geometries available in stainless steel rotor descriptions
- Shaft length: 450 mm, shaft diameter: 8 mm
